Road Crack Repair in Orange County, CA
Road crack repair services focus on restoring the integrity of asphalt and concrete surfaces affected by cracking. These services typically address a variety of projects, including residential driveways, sidewalks, parking lots, and roadways. The process involves filling and sealing cracks to prevent water infiltration, which can lead to further deterioration, and to improve the overall appearance and safety of the surface. Property owners often seek this service to maintain a smooth, durable surface, prevent costly repairs in the future, and enhance curb appeal.
Before requesting road crack rep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the cracking, the types of materials used for repairs, and how the work will impact the surface’s longevity. It’s also helpful to know if the cracks are caused by underlying issues such as soil movement or drainage problems, which may require additional solutions. Clarifying these details can ensure the repair work effectively addresses current issues and helps prevent future damage.

Road Crack Repair Questions
What types of cracks can be repaired? Common cracks such as surface, longitudinal, and transverse can be fixed to restore pavement integrity and appearance.
Is crack repair suitable for all pavement types? Most asphalt and concrete surfaces can benefit from crack repair to prevent further damage and deterioration.
What are the benefits of repairing cracks? Repairing cracks helps prevent water infiltration, reduces trip hazards, and extends the lifespan of the pavement.
When should crack repair be considered? Crack repair is recommended when cracks are small and not yet causing significant pavement issues, to prevent escalation.
